Croatian midfielder Gabrić injured in car crash

Trabzonspor AŞ midfielder and Croatian international Drago Gabrić is in a serious condition in hospital after sustaining head injuries in a car accident near Split on Monday evening.

Trabzonspor AŞ midfielder Drago Gabrić is in a serious condition in hospital after being involved in a car accident near Split on Monday evening.

The Croatian international, who spent the 2010/11 season on loan at MKE Ankaragücü, was driving when his vehicle veered off the road. The 24-year-old is in a coma and also has a fractured skull. Another passenger who was also in the car at the time walked away from the accident with minor injuries.

Gabrić, who has made five appearances for Croatia and was included in Slaven Bilić's squad for their forthcoming UEFA EURO 2012 qualifying match against Georgia in Split, is the son of former HNK Hajduk Split goalkeeper Tonći Gabrić.
